SORU
11 Temmuz 2009, CUMARTESİ


Paralel Yapar.Dosyalarda grup aktif iş parçacığı sayısını sınırlar?

Eğer

var arrayStrings = new string[1000];
Parallel.ForEach<string>(arrayStrings, someString =>
{
    DoSomething(someString);
});

1000 Konuları neredeyse aynı anda doğacaktır.

CEVAP
11 Temmuz 2009, CUMARTESİ


Hayır, 1000 iş parçacığı çalışmıyor - Evet, çok iş parçacığı nasıl kullanıldığını sınırlar. Paralel Uzantıları çekirdek uygun sayıda, kaç tane fiziksel olarak var dayalı kullanırvekaç zaten meşgul. Her çekirdek için işe ayırır ve sonra da denilen bir tekniği kullanırhırsızlık bir işher iş parçacığı kendi sıra verimli ve sadece işleme izin gerçekten gerektiğinde çapraz iş parçacığı herhangi bir pahalı erişim yapmak lazım.

PFX Team Blog bir göz atyükleriş ve diğer konularda her türlü ayırır hakkında bilgi.

Bazı durumlarda istediğiniz paralellik derecesini de belirleyebilirsiniz unutmayın.

Bunu Paylaş:
  • Google+
  • E-Posta
Etiketler:

YORUMLAR

SPONSOR VİDEO

Rastgele Yazarlar

  • Bart Baker

    Bart Baker

    1 Aralık 2006
  • Christian Atlas

    Christian At

    26 Mart 2009
  • spyib

    spyib

    9 Ocak 2007